Maintaining a healthy blood sugar level is crucial for adults over 50, regardless of their medical history or fitness level. While many people associate high blood sugar levels with diabetes, even those without the condition can benefit from monitoring and managing their glucose levels.

What's Considered Normal Blood Sugar Range for Adults?

The American Diabetes Association recommends that fasting plasma glucose (FPG) levels be below 100 milligrams per deciliter (mg/dL). After meals, blood sugar should return to normal within two hours. For adults over 50, the ideal range is between 70 and 99 mg/dL for FPG and less than or equal to 140 mg/dl one hour after eating.

Diet's Role in Regulating Blood Sugar Levels

A well-balanced diet plays a vital role in maintaining normal blood sugar levels. Foods with low glycemic index (GI), such as whole grains, non-starchy vegetables, lean proteins, and healthy fats, should be the cornerstone of an adult's diet after 50. Incorporating fiber-rich foods can also help slow down glucose absorption into the bloodstream.

Exercise: A Powerful Tool for Blood Sugar Control

Regular physical activity is not only beneficial for cardiovascular health but also plays a significant role in regulating blood sugar levels. Adults over 50 should a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ity aerobic exercise, or 75 minutes of vigorous-intensity aerobic exercise per week.

Managing Stress to Maintain Stable Blood Sugar Levels

Stress can have a detrimental impact on blood sugar regulation. High cortisol levels due to stress can raise glucose in the bloodstream and reduce insulin sensitivity. Engaging in relaxation techniques such as deep breathing exercises, meditation, or yoga may help manage stress effectively.

The Importance of Sleep for Healthy Blood Sugar Regulation

Poor sleep quality has been linked to impaired insulin sensitivity and an increased risk of developing diabetes. Adults over 50 should prioritize a consistent sleeping schedule and maintain good sleep hygiene practices to support healthy blood sugar levels.
